AI-Powered Electronics Manufacturing Services (EMS) Marketplace for India

India's electronics manufacturing market is projected to reach $300B+ by 2026, driven by PLI schemes and China+1 diversification. Yet EMS (Electronics Manufacturing Services) remains fragmented—thousands of PCB assemblers, box-builders, and component suppliers operate in silos. No AI-first platform exists to match OEM product companies with certified EMS partners, automate RFQ workflows, or enable quality-tracked production. This article explores how AI agents can transform Electronics Manufacturing Services procurement for India's emerging hardware startup ecosystem.

Executive Summary

India's electronics manufacturing sector is experiencing unprecedented growth—from $76B (2022) to projected $300B+ (2026). The Production-Linked Incentive (PLI) scheme has attracted $25B+ in investments from Apple suppliers Foxconn, Pegatron, and Wistron. Yet hardware startups and mid-sized OEMs struggle to find trusted EMS partners for PCB assembly, box-building, and mass production.

The Gap: No unified marketplace connects product companies with certified EMS providers. No AI capability exists to match design files to capable manufacturers, track quality metrics, or enable WhatsApp-native production management. Key Opportunity: Build an AI-powered EMS marketplace that reads design files (Gerber, Eagle, KiCAD), matches to verified manufacturers, provides real-time production tracking, and enables end-to-end WhatsApp coordination.

Why Incumbents Will Struggle

Existing EMS providers focus on large orders (10K+ units). No platform serves the explosive market of hardware startups building in small batches (100-5,000 units). The "mass production" players ignore early-stage companies—precisely where India has competitive advantage via design innovation.

    Gaps in the Market

    Gap 1: AI Design-to-Manufacture Matching

    No platform reads design files (Gerber, ODB++, IPC-2541) and matches to capable manufacturers based on capabilities, location, and pricing.

    Gap 2: Verified EMS Network

    No standardized capability badges (ISO certified, cleanroom class, min/max order size, turnkey vs. consignment).

    Gap 3: Real-Time Production Tracking

    No platform provides production milestone visibility (material procure → SMT → through-hole → test → pack → ship).

    Gap 4: Quality Documentation Automation

    No platform auto-generates inspection reports, traceability docs, and compliance certifications.

    Gap 5: WhatsApp-Native Production Updates

    No platform pushes daily production photos, defect rates, and shipping updates via WhatsApp.

    AI Disruption Angle

    How AI Agents Transform the Workflow

    Today:
    Startup → Research manufacturers → Cold call/email → Wait for quote → Negotiate → Prepaying deposit → Hope for quality -> Chase updates
    With AI Platform:
    Startup → Upload design files → AI analyzes DFM → Match to 5-10 capable EMS → Receive quotes in 24h → Select via WhatsApp → Track production automatically

    Key AI Capabilities

  • DesignReader AI
  • - Parse Gerber, Eagle, KiCAD, Altium files - Extract layer count, board dimensions, component density - Flag design-for-manufacture issues - Estimate BOM costs automatically
  • MatchMaker AI
  • - Match design requirements to EMS capabilities - Rank by proximity, capacity, certifications - Predict lead times based on current loading - Optimize for cost vs. speed tradeoff
  • QualityTracker AI
  • - Accept inspection photos at each stage - Detect defects using computer vision - Generate IPC-610 compliance reports - Flag anomalies for rework
  • ComponentIntelligence
  • - Match BOM to distributor inventory - Suggest substitutions for shortages - Track lead times across DigiKey, Mouser, Arrow - Alert on obsolete parts
  • WhatsAppProduction Agent
  • - Push daily progress photos - Share inspection reports - Notify on shipping with tracking - Enable reorder conversations
